Transaction 590e08486b2cb33fd41f9f1a3e1b411ad76407e52e78403cd4ec901bc686f013
2 Input
2 Outputs
- 590e08486b2cb33fd41f9f1a3e1b411ad76407e52e78403cd4ec901bc686f013:0
- 590e08486b2cb33fd41f9f1a3e1b411ad76407e52e78403cd4ec901bc686f013:1
value 1225499
address 1GQdrgqAbkeEPUef1UpiTc4X1mUHMcyuGW
value 694671
address 3F3SyQEL96HvpmwhJs7qnY1jTuwsWBBs9H